Julian Alvarez is once again dominating transfer conversations after reports emerged that Barcelona formally submitted a €100 million bid for the Atletico Madrid superstar. What initially looked like another transfer rumor has evolved into a high-profile dispute between two Spanish giants, with one side insisting the offer exists and the other previously denying its arrival. The Julian Alvarez pursuit appears significantly more advanced than many observers first believed. Reports indicate Barcelona submitted a formal €100 million bid directly to Atletico Madrid’s sporting leadership via email. Sources close to Barcelona reportedly confirmed the proposal, presenting the move as a standard transfer operation rather than a publicity stunt.

What makes the situation remarkable is the public disagreement surrounding the offer. Atletico Madrid had previously dismissed reports that any official proposal had arrived, describing such claims as inaccurate. The conflicting narratives have added an unusual layer of intrigue to an already expensive negotiation. The wider context surrounding Julian Alvarez suggests the transfer story may not disappear anytime soon. Atletico view the Argentine as a cornerstone of their project and have repeatedly emphasized his long-term importance. Reports have also linked the player with interest from other elite clubs, although Barcelona are believed to be among the strongest admirers of the forward.

The €100 million bid itself may only represent the opening chapter. Various reports suggest Atletico value Alvarez considerably higher than Barcelona’s initial proposal. That means even if both clubs agree an offer was submitted, agreeing on a final price could prove even more difficult. In modern football, €100 million is an enormous amount of money; in elite transfer negotiations, it sometimes serves merely as an opening greeting.

Barcelona’s interest is understandable. Alvarez possesses the versatility, work rate, technical quality, and goal-scoring instincts that fit the profile of a long-term attacking leader. At a time when clubs across Europe are searching for elite forwards capable of performing on the biggest stages, the Argentine remains one of the most attractive options on the market.

Atletico Madrid, however, are under no immediate pressure to sell. The club sees Alvarez as a central figure in its sporting project, and any negotiation is likely to be conducted from a position of strength. That reality could force Barcelona to either increase their offer substantially or explore alternative targets should discussions fail to progress.
